Installation builds FresnoCommissioning is where our installs differ from most. Launch monitor calibration, altitude set to your actual elevation rather than the sea level default the software ships with, projector geometry checked against the screen, then a gapping session so you leave with your own carry numbers written down. That last step is the one most installers skip and it is the one that makes the room useful.
| Decision | Amenity build | Revenue build |
|---|---|---|
| Screen grade | Commercial rated. Guests swing hard. | Commercial rated, replaced on schedule. |
| Acoustics | Treat if adjacent to guest rooms. | Treat always. It is the top post opening complaint. |
| Measurement accuracy | Good enough. Guests cannot tell. | Good enough, unless you also run fittings. |
| Leading priority | Reliability with zero staff support. | Throughput and reset time between groups. |
| Booking | Optional, often front desk managed. | Essential. Manual booking eats a shift. |
| Peak indoor demand | November through February in California, driven by rain and short winter daylight. | Same window, and you are selling it by the hour. |

The simulator itself is equipment rather than construction, so usually not. Associated work can be a different matter: new circuits, structural changes or a new outbuilding are typically permitted work, and requirements vary by municipality. Check with your local building department in {city} early, and we will tell you which parts of the scope are likely to need it.
